Storyhouse Belvédère

On Wednesday 27 November we would like to invite you to Verhalenhuis Belvédère for the final event of Soupspoon’s project in collaboration with TENT and Reading Room Rotterdam. Since late summer, Soupspoon has regularly visited Belvédère for guided tours and shared meals, exploring Rotterdam’s migrant histories and sharing stories over warm dishes. Their final event in this collaboration, Temple Making, invites you to a joint exploration of the spirit of place and time.

Based on gathered insights and shared experiences, Soupspoon will lead a workshop inviting participants to reimagine the concept of a temple—not as a religious site, but as a space for anchoring, reverence, and reflection on the discontinuities that shape our lives. Using materials provided and personal offerings you choose to bring, participants will co-create altars with thoughtful prompts throughout the space. These altars will then be brought together in a ritual, forming a symbolic temple that celebrates our shared journey of living together.

A light buffet inspired by temple offerings will be served throughout the evening. We look forward to sharing this evening with you!

This event is in English.
